Rumor: No GTA IV DLC Until “January or February” 2009
by Keane Ng on August 28, 2008

Rumors sprouted earlier this week than GTA IV’s 360-exclusive downloadable content would be ready for release this November, but now the ever-churning rumor mill is telling us that it won’t be ready until January or Feburary next year.
Citing a “source close to Rockstar,” VG247 is reporting that Microsoft is “wrong” to expect anything before winter next year. Their source reportedly said:
It’ll be in January or February
Snow might be falling when we finally get our hands on any new adventures in Liberty City.

Record Label Pushes Three New GH3 Songs
by Wade Larson on August 10, 2008
Flyleaf (pictured above, minus singer Lacey Mosley) join Guitar Hero as DLC
If you’ve played through every track on Guitar Hero III: Legends of Rock, there are now some fresh tunes courtesy of Interscope Records.
The Interscope Track Pack offers up three new songs: Flyleaf’s “Tina,” “Carcinogen Crush” by AFI, and a remix of goth rocker Marilyn Manson’s “Putting Holes in Happiness,” a la Nick Zinner of the Yeah Yeah Yeahs.
The tracks are now available on Xbox Live and the PlayStation Store.

Take-Two Say GTA DLC Delayed, Microsoft in Denial, or Not
by John Kershaw on June 8, 2008

A few days ago, Take-Two announced that the first episode of the Xbox 360 exclusive DLC for GTA 4 was going to be delayed until next year. The following day, a Microsoft spokesman said it was still on track for a Fall 2008 release.
